Top Licensed Jurisdictions for Non-GamStop Casinos
When choosing international gaming platforms, the regulatory authority serves as the main measure of legitimacy, consumer safeguards, and operational integrity. Reputable international gaming authorities maintain rigorous regulations regarding fair gaming, fund protection, player protection initiatives, and dispute resolution processes. UK players should prioritize casinos licensed by established jurisdictions with proven track records of compliance monitoring and consumer representation. The leading regulatory bodies provide clear complaint procedures, conduct regular audits of operators, and enforce significant penalties for non-compliance. Understanding the distinctions among regulators helps players find casinos that balance regulatory standards with accessible gaming options outside the GamStop framework.
| Licensing Authority | Jurisdiction | Regulatory Strength | Key Features |
|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) | Malta | Superior | Strong player safeguards, rigorous financial oversight, transparent dispute resolution, frequent operator reviews |
| Curacao eGaming | Curacao | Reasonable | Flexible regulations, quicker licensing timeline, lower operational costs, varied sub-licenses with different standards |
| Kahnawake Gaming Commission | Canada | Good | Long-standing credibility from 1996, customer dispute resolution, gaming technical requirements, responsible gaming obligations |
| Gibraltar Regulatory Authority | Gibraltar | Superior | Stringent compliance standards, financial stability requirements, consumer protection focus, recognized jurisdiction |
| Anjouan Gaming License | Comoros | Minimal | Minimal regulatory oversight, lower credibility, restricted player safeguards, generally less recommended |
The Malta Gaming Authority represents the gold standard among offshore regulatory organizations, delivering extensive regulatory guidelines similar to the UK Gambling Commission in many respects.
Gibraltar and Kahnawake offer strong player safeguards with set complaint procedures, while Curacao offers a middle ground with different requirements depending on the specific sub-license.
